What is my Virginia adjusted gross income for 2023 and am I required to file tax return if all the income is interest?
If your Virginia adjusted gross income is below the filing threshold, your tax is zero.
I earned about $18500 in investment interest and $3000 in long and short-term net capital loss, $0 in traditional IRA/HSA contributions (since I am ineligible for tax deductions due to$0 W2/1099 income), so my federal AGI should be $15500. I also contributed $4000 to pre-tax Virginia 529 (up to $4000 income tax deduction). I am not sure if my Virginia AGI is $15500 or $11500, which is below the filing threshold.
